The fabric of the old school has been used to form part of the foundations for the new school. The three-storey building will be one of the most sustainably designed schools in the country with additional facilities to support the pastoral care and emotional well-being of the students. Funding has come from a local benefactor to create expanded sports facilities. The new build project is on time and on schedule with completion due in late , and the new buildings open for use at the beginning of After this, more old buildings will be demolished apart from the Beloe and Desborough blocks and the final works will begin on the parking areas and landscaping.

The new building works will not provide more school places - the numbers remain at students per year group and in the Sixth Form. You can see progress on the build at www. Making a difference C ommunity Action Dacorum is a charity that supports individuals and organisations in Dacorum Borough and beyond. Community Action Dacorum offers local residents a wide range of services that improve their lives. The Repair Shed, for instance, is a series of three workshops around the Borough that allow people to come together to tinker in a shed, make friends and share their lives.

The latest shed is being built with Sunnyside Rural. Trust as you read this in Northchurch for people in Tring and Berkhamsted who want to get involved. Shedders as they like to be known fix things, build new items out of wood and metal and sell them to keep their shed running. To get involved email tony communityactiondacorum. Other projects under way include: Innoculation volunteers - recruiting people to help at vaccination centres marshal patients, be patient advocates, ensure people remain well after the vaccination and to administer the program.

Email volunteering communityactiondacorum. Volunteer drivers help those who are struggling to get to the vaccination centres. The charity has also partnered with Masons Coaches.

Separated partners can ask the Courts to deal with the regulation of ownership and sale of property on principles of Trust and Property Law. They can potentially seek financial support from their ex-partner for the benefit of their children and can apply for Child Arrangements and other Court Orders under the Children Act Unfortunately for separating partners, this is largely the extent of it.

The Courts are not concerned with fairness, the overall picture or maintenance for the benefit of one of the former partners.
